Abstract
A bulk drug dispensing device, comprising: a medicine storage bin (1), wherein the bottom of the medicine storage bin (1) is provided with an outlet (11); the material stirring device (2) comprises a feeding channel (21), a material stirring wheel (22) arranged in the feeding channel (21) and a driving device (23) for driving the material stirring wheel (22) to rotate, the top end of the feeding channel (21) is in butt joint with the outlet (11) of the medicine storage bin (1), and a plurality of bulges (221) are arranged on the wheel outer edge of the material stirring wheel (22); the spiral feeding device (3) comprises a feeding channel (31), a spiral spring (32) arranged in the feeding channel (31) and a driving device (33) for driving the spiral spring (32) to rotate; the spiral spring (32) is rotatably erected inside the feeding channel (31) along the length direction of the feeding channel (31).

Background
The traditional Chinese medicine is a precious wealth of Chinese nationality, and makes a great contribution to the prosperity of the Chinese nationality. The treatment concept of traditional medicine is gradually accepted in the world, the traditional medicine is more and more concerned by the international society, the demand of the traditional medicine in the world is increasing, and the wide space is provided for the development of the traditional medicine.
The traditional Chinese medicine related to the traditional Chinese medicine is composed of plant medicines (roots, stems, leaves, fruits), animal medicines (internal organs, skins, bones, organs and the like) and mineral medicines, is various and irregular in shape, and even though automatic medicine sorting equipment such as an automatic pharmacy exists in the market, the existing automatic medicine sorting equipment is not suitable due to the special characteristics of the irregular appearance of the traditional Chinese medicine, so that the traditional Chinese medicine is still grabbed and weighed manually in pharmacies and traditional Chinese medicine shops of various major and middle hospitals at present, which is labor-consuming and low in efficiency.
In analysis, the difficulty in realizing automatic sorting of traditional Chinese medicines mainly lies in how to quantitatively output the traditional Chinese medicines because the traditional Chinese medicines are irregular in shape, so that the development of a quantitative medicine outputting device which aims at the bulk traditional Chinese medicines and is accurate in quantification, simple in structure and high in efficiency is a problem to be researched urgently.

Detailed Description
The invention will be further described with reference to the following drawings and examples:
example (b): referring to FIGS. 1-4:
a bulk medicine discharging device is characterized by comprising a medicine storage bin 1, a material poking device 2, a spiral feeding device 3 and a weighing device 4.
The lower part (as the bottom in the figure) of the medicine storage bin 1 is provided with an outlet 11; the material stirring device 2 comprises a feeding channel 21, a material stirring wheel 22 arranged in the feeding channel 21 and a driving device 23 for driving the material stirring wheel 22 to rotate, wherein the upper part of the feeding channel 21 is butted with an outlet 11 of the medicine storage bin 1, the material stirring wheel 22 is axially and rotatably erected, the axial length of the material stirring wheel 22 penetrates through the outlet 11 of the medicine storage bin 1, a plurality of bulges 221 are arranged on the wheel outer edge of the material stirring wheel 22, and the bulges 221 are uniformly distributed on the circumferential direction of the material stirring wheel 22; the bottom end of the feeding channel 21 is provided with an outlet 211, and the length direction of the outlet 211 is parallel to the axial direction of the kick-out wheel 22.
The spiral feeding device 3 comprises a feeding channel 31, a spiral spring 32 arranged in the feeding channel 31 and a driving device 33 for driving the spiral spring 32 to rotate; one end of the feeding channel 31 in the length direction is used as a medicine outlet 311, and the top or the side of the feeding channel 31 is provided with an inlet which is in butt joint with the outlet 211 of the material stirring device 2; the coil spring 32 is rotatably mounted inside the feeding passage 31 along the length direction of the feeding passage 31. The helical spring 32 can in particular also be replaced by a screw.
The inner cavity of the medicine storage bin 1 is a tapered cavity with a small top and a big bottom, and is particularly in a frustum shape or a pyramid frustum shape, so that the traditional Chinese medicine can not be blocked in the medicine storage bin 1 and can smoothly fall down.
The axial length of the helical spring 32 is parallel to and corresponds to the length direction of the outlet 211 of the kick-out device 2, and the axial length of the helical spring 32 penetrates through the whole length of the long-strip-shaped outlet 211 of the kick-out device 2.
The protrusions 221 are strip-shaped sheet-shaped bodies, and the length direction of each protrusion 211 is arranged along the axial direction of the material shifting wheel 22. The projection 221 is a uniform cross-sectional body, and is formed by a root portion 2211 fixed to the setting wheel 22 and a tip portion 2212 in cross section, and the width of the tip portion 2212 is smaller than that of the root portion 2211. In practice, the protrusions 221 may also be rods, the length direction of which is arranged at an angle to the axial direction of the kick-off wheel 22.
The weighing device 4 comprises a weighing hopper 41 and a weighing sensor 42, the weighing hopper 41 is arranged opposite to the medicine outlet 311 of the spiral feeding device 3 and is used for receiving the traditional Chinese medicine sent out from the medicine outlet 311, and the weighing hopper 41 is installed on the rack through the weighing sensor 42.
When the automatic medicine feeding device works, traditional Chinese medicines are stored in the medicine storage bin 1, the driving device 23 is started to enable the material stirring wheel 22 to rotate, the protrusions 221 on the material stirring wheel 22 stir the traditional Chinese medicines little by little and send the traditional Chinese medicines into the feeding channel 31 of the spiral feeding device 3 continuously, then the spiral spring 32 rotates to send the traditional Chinese medicines in the feeding channel 31 to the medicine outlet 311 through the driving of the driving device 33, the traditional Chinese medicines continuously fall into the weighing device 4 in a small amount for weighing, when the weight fed back by the weighing device 4 is reached, the driving device 33 is controlled to stop immediately, the spiral spring 32 stops rotating, the medicine feeding is stopped, and the weighing accuracy is guaranteed.
The utility model discloses a material wheel 22 and coil spring 32 or the screw rod's combined action have been solved and have been conveyed the stifled difficult problem of traditional chinese medicine card, the specially adapted conveying herbal medicine.
